JEE Math Practice Question
Let $$L_1: \vec{r}=(\hat{i}-\hat{j}+2 \hat{k})+\lambda(\hat{i}-\hat{j}+2 \hat{k}), \lambda \in \mathbb{R}$$, $$L_2: \vec{r}=(\hat{j}-\hat{k})+\mu(3 \hat{i}+\hat{j}+p \hat{k}), \mu \in \mathbb{R} \text {, and } L_3: \vec{r}=\delta(\ell \hat{i}+m \hat{j}+n \hat{k}), \delta \in \mathbb{R}$$ be three lines such that $$L_1$$ is perpendicular to $$L_2$$ and $$L_3$$ is perpendicular to both $$L_1$$ and $$L_2$$. Then, the point which lies on $$L_3$$ is
- A.$$(1,7,-4)$$
- B.$$(1,-7,4)$$
- C.$$(-1,7,4)$$
- D.$$(-, 1-7,4)$$
